Trustees Adjo Meeting _ .

A meeting of the Trustees was held
according to adjournment on Monday
. ~

There were present
the President Messrs Cheever, Crocker, Curtis,
Gould, Nazro and Tisdale _ seven. ~

The reading of the records was dispursed
with.

Lots and Spaces - Rept of Comee not adopted.

The President for the Committee to consider what amend-
ment, alteration or addition ought to be made to Art.
16 of the By Laws, entitled "Lots and Spaces", submitted a
draft containing additions and alterations of the Article
as originally adopted, unanimously agreed to by the committee.

Moved by Mr. Tisdale to strike out the word
"side" in the fourth line of the report, so as to preserve the same
space in the rear of the lots that is to be preserved upon the sides.

The motion was lost.

It was then moved by Mr Cheever that the report
be accepted.

This motion was also lost, not receiving
the requisite number - five, so that the article remained
as originally adopted. _
